通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何将python添加到路径

如何将python添加到路径

如何将Python添加到路径

要将Python添加到系统路径中,您需要更新环境变量,使得操作系统能够找到Python解释器。下载并安装Python、通过系统设置添加Python到路径、使用命令行添加Python到路径、验证Python路径配置。下面详细解释如何通过系统设置和命令行来完成这项任务。

一、下载并安装Python

在开始之前,确保您已经下载并安装了Python。如果尚未安装,您可以从Python官方网站下载最新版本。安装过程中,务必勾选“Add Python to PATH”选项,这样可以在安装时自动将Python添加到路径中。

二、通过系统设置添加Python到路径

1. Windows系统

在Windows系统上,您可以通过以下步骤将Python添加到路径:

  1. 打开系统属性:右键点击“此电脑”或“我的电脑”图标,选择“属性”。
  2. 进入高级系统设置:在弹出的窗口中,点击左侧的“高级系统设置”。
  3. 打开环境变量:在“高级”选项卡中,点击“环境变量”按钮。
  4. 编辑Path变量:在“系统变量”部分,找到并选择“Path”变量,然后点击“编辑”按钮。
  5. 添加Python路径:在弹出的编辑窗口中,点击“新建”按钮,然后输入Python安装目录的路径(例如:C:\Python39,具体路径根据您的安装位置而定)。如果需要,还可以添加Scripts目录的路径(例如:C:\Python39\Scripts)。
  6. 保存更改:点击“确定”按钮保存更改,直到所有窗口关闭。

2. MacOS系统

在MacOS系统上,您可以通过以下步骤将Python添加到路径:

  1. 打开终端:按Command + Space打开Spotlight搜索,输入“Terminal”并回车。
  2. 编辑shell配置文件:根据您使用的shell类型,编辑相应的配置文件。如果使用的是Bash shell,编辑.bash_profile文件;如果使用的是Zsh shell,编辑.zshrc文件。可以使用nanovim编辑器进行修改,例如:
    nano ~/.bash_profile

  3. 添加Python路径:在文件中添加以下内容,将/usr/local/bin/python3替换为您的Python安装路径:
    export PATH="/usr/local/bin/python3:$PATH"

  4. 保存并退出:保存文件并退出编辑器(在nano中,按Ctrl + X,然后按Y,最后按回车)。
  5. 刷新配置:运行以下命令刷新配置文件:
    source ~/.bash_profile

三、使用命令行添加Python到路径

1. Windows系统

您还可以通过命令行添加Python到路径:

  1. 打开命令提示符:按Win + R打开运行窗口,输入cmd并回车。
  2. 查看当前路径:运行以下命令查看当前路径:
    echo %PATH%

  3. 添加Python路径:运行以下命令添加Python路径,将C:\Python39替换为您的Python安装路径:
    setx PATH "%PATH%;C:\Python39"

2. MacOS系统

在MacOS系统上,您可以通过以下步骤使用命令行添加Python到路径:

  1. 打开终端:按Command + Space打开Spotlight搜索,输入“Terminal”并回车。
  2. 编辑shell配置文件:根据您使用的shell类型,编辑相应的配置文件。如果使用的是Bash shell,编辑.bash_profile文件;如果使用的是Zsh shell,编辑.zshrc文件。可以使用nanovim编辑器进行修改,例如:
    nano ~/.bash_profile

  3. 添加Python路径:在文件中添加以下内容,将/usr/local/bin/python3替换为您的Python安装路径:
    export PATH="/usr/local/bin/python3:$PATH"

  4. 保存并退出:保存文件并退出编辑器(在nano中,按Ctrl + X,然后按Y,最后按回车)。
  5. 刷新配置:运行以下命令刷新配置文件:
    source ~/.bash_profile

四、验证Python路径配置

无论使用哪种方法添加Python到路径,您都可以通过以下步骤验证配置是否成功:

  1. 打开命令提示符或终端:按上述步骤打开命令提示符或终端。
  2. 检查Python版本:运行以下命令检查Python版本:
    python --version

    如果看到Python版本信息,说明Python已经成功添加到路径中。

五、常见问题及解决方法

1. 安装Python后找不到Python解释器

如果您在安装Python后无法找到Python解释器,请确保安装过程中勾选了“Add Python to PATH”选项。如果未勾选,可以通过上述步骤手动添加Python到路径。

2. Python路径配置错误

如果Python路径配置错误,可能会导致无法找到Python解释器。请仔细检查路径是否正确,并确保没有拼写错误。

3. 环境变量冲突

在某些情况下,可能会出现环境变量冲突,导致Python解释器无法正常工作。可以尝试将Python路径放在环境变量的开头,确保Python解释器优先被找到。

六、使用虚拟环境管理Python依赖

在开发Python项目时,建议使用虚拟环境来管理Python依赖。虚拟环境可以隔离不同项目的依赖,避免版本冲突。您可以使用venv模块创建虚拟环境:

  1. 创建虚拟环境:运行以下命令创建虚拟环境,将myenv替换为虚拟环境名称:
    python -m venv myenv

  2. 激活虚拟环境:运行以下命令激活虚拟环境:
    • Windows系统:
      myenv\Scripts\activate

    • MacOS和Linux系统:
      source myenv/bin/activate

  3. 安装依赖:激活虚拟环境后,您可以使用pip命令安装依赖:
    pip install package_name

  4. 退出虚拟环境:完成开发后,可以运行以下命令退出虚拟环境:
    deactivate

七、总结

通过上述步骤,您可以轻松将Python添加到系统路径中,并验证配置是否成功。无论是通过系统设置还是命令行,添加Python到路径都是确保Python解释器正常工作的关键步骤。此外,使用虚拟环境管理Python依赖,可以有效隔离不同项目的依赖,避免版本冲突。希望本文对您有所帮助,祝您在Python学习和开发中取得成功!

相关问答FAQs:

如何确认Python是否已经添加到我的系统路径中?
要确认Python是否已经添加到系统路径,可以在命令行或终端中输入python --versionpython3 --version。如果返回Python的版本信息,说明Python已经成功添加到路径中。如果出现“未找到命令”或类似的错误,则需要手动添加Python到系统路径。

在Windows系统中,如何手动将Python添加到路径?
在Windows中,您可以通过以下步骤手动添加Python到系统路径:右击“此电脑”或“我的电脑”,选择“属性”,然后点击“高级系统设置”。在“系统属性”窗口中,选择“环境变量”。在“系统变量”部分找到“Path”变量,选择后点击“编辑”。在编辑窗口中,添加Python的安装路径(例如C:\Python39)和Python的Scripts目录(例如C:\Python39\Scripts),然后保存更改。

在Mac或Linux系统中,如何将Python添加到路径?
在Mac或Linux系统中,可以通过修改~/.bash_profile~/.bashrc文件来添加Python到路径。打开终端,输入nano ~/.bash_profilenano ~/.bashrc,然后在文件末尾添加以下行:export PATH="/usr/local/bin/python3:$PATH"(假设Python安装在/usr/local/bin/python3)。保存文件后,运行source ~/.bash_profilesource ~/.bashrc以使更改生效。

相关文章